编程界面设计

超锟 阅读:416 2024-05-19 09:34:53 评论:0

探索界面设计小编程:从基础到实践

界面设计是软件开发中至关重要的一环,它直接影响用户体验和产品的成功。而界面设计小编程则是探索如何通过编程技能来实现各种吸引人的用户界面。在本文中,我们将从基础知识到实际应用,深入探讨界面设计小编程的方方面面。

1. 界面设计基础

在开始界面设计小编程之前,我们需要了解一些基础概念和原则:

用户体验 (UX)

:用户体验是用户在使用产品时的感受和情感反馈。好的用户体验可以提高用户满意度和产品的可用性。

用户界面 (UI)

:用户界面是用户与产品进行交互的界面,包括图形界面、声音界面等。良好的用户界面设计可以使用户操作更加方便和直观。

设计原则

:界面设计需要遵循一些设计原则,如简约性、一致性、可视化等,以提高用户体验和产品的可用性。

2. 编程技能

在界面设计小编程中,我们通常会使用以下编程技能:

HTML/CSS

:HTML用于创建网页结构,CSS用于设置网页样式,它们是实现网页界面的基础。

JavaScript

:JavaScript是一种用于网页交互的脚本语言,它可以实现动态效果和用户交互功能。

UI库/框架

:UI库或框架如Bootstrap、React等可以帮助我们快速构建具有吸引力和响应式设计的界面。

3. 实践指南

让我们通过一个简单的示例来演示界面设计小编程的实践过程:

示例:创建一个简单的登录界面

我们将使用HTML、CSS和JavaScript来创建一个简单的登录界面,具有输入用户名和密码的功能,并且可以验证用户输入。

```html

登录界面

```

```css

/* styles.css */

.container {

maxwidth: 400px;

margin: 0 auto;

padding: 20px;

border: 1px solid ccc;

borderradius: 5px;

}

.formgroup {

marginbottom: 20px;

}

label {

display: block;

marginbottom: 5px;

}

input[type="text"],

input[type="password"] {

width: 100%;

padding: 8px;

border: 1px solid ccc;

borderradius: 3px;

}

button {

width: 100%;

padding: 10px;

backgroundcolor: 007bff;

color: fff;

border: none;

borderradius: 3px;

cursor: pointer;

}

button:hover {

backgroundcolor: 0056b3;

}

```

```javascript

// script.js

document.getElementById("loginForm").addEventListener("submit", function(event) {

event.preventDefault();

var username = document.getElementById("username").value;

var password = document.getElementById("password").value;

// 在此处添加验证逻辑,例如:

if (username === "admin" && password === "123") {

document.getElementById("message").innerText = "登录成功!";

} else {

document.getElementById("message").innerText = "用户名或密码错误!";

}

});

```

在这个示例中,我们创建了一个简单的登录界面,包括输入用户名和密码的表单,并通过JavaScript来验证用户输入的用户名和密码是否正确。

结论

通过学习界面设计小编程,我们可以掌握创建吸引人的用户界面的技能,并将其应用于实际项目中。这不仅可以提高我们的编程能力,还可以改善产品的用户体验,从而使产品更加成功。

无论是初学者还是有经验的开发人员,都可以从界面设计小编程中获益,不断提升自己在软件开发领域的竞争力。

搜索
排行榜
最近发表
关注我们

扫一扫关注我们,了解最新精彩内容